摘要:
为把江心洲建设成生态科技岛,分别采用厌氧生物滤池、净化浮岛工艺对洲泰村生活污水进行处理,采用生物滤池、人工湿地、稳定塘工艺对永定村西组养殖废水和生活污水进行处理,采用厌氧塘、兼性塘、生物塘工艺对白鹭村生活污水进行处理,采用一体式生物接触氧化、土地渗滤工艺对永定村东组生活污水进行处理。实际运行结果表明,四种处理工艺均达到《城镇污水处理厂排放标准》(GB18918-2002)的一级B 标准,同时运行管理简单、建设和运行费用低,对农村具有良好的应用推广价值。
Abstract:
For the construction of Jiangxinzhou Eco-Tech Island,anaerobic filter,purification floating island process was used to treat the Zhoutai Village sewage,the biological filter,artificial wetland,stabilization pond process was used to treat the West Group of Yongding Village aquaculture wastewater and sewage,anaerobic pond,facultative pond and biological pond process was used to treat the Bailu Village sewage.The integrated biological contact oxidation,soil infiltration process was used to treat the East Group of Yongding Village sewage.The operation results show that the four processes have met the first class,B standard of “discharge standard of pollutants for municipal wastewater treatment plant”(GB18918-2002).At the same time,thanks to simple operation,management and low operation cost,the technology has good application value in rural areas.
